Hajja is a settlement located in the western coastal region of Morocco, near Rabat.[1] The earliest recorded history of the general vicinity is associated with the now-ruined Chellah, situated along the estuarine portion of the Oued Bou Regreg. Chellah was originally settled by the Phoenicians and later became a Roman settlement.[2]
